There is no application form and no approval decision to wait for. A buying relationship with CAPRA starts with one enquiry, and is confirmed in writing per order.
We reply within one business day, and send current availability by the second.
Registered or trading name, and a website, shopfront or marketplace profile if you have one. This is what separates a trade enquiry from a consumer one.
Brands or categories. Men’s, women’s, kids. Sizes and season preferences if you already know them.
An approximate first order size. A range is fine — it tells us which offer sheets are relevant to you.
The destination market. Delivery arrangements are confirmed per order and destination.
CAPRA works from current supplier offer sheets, which change every week. That is why there is no standing catalogue to log into — the useful answer is the one written against this week’s availability.
